Description

A remarkable correspondence exists between lattices generated by discrete Jordan algebras and symmetries of superstrings, strongly suggesting that all known superstring theories are related and descend from a more general theory related to the Conway–Sloane transhyperbolic group. Cartan tori has visible spaces and G/H Cartan generators as dark builders of G and determined by root lattices. E10 is shown as the dark group of the visible (9 + 1) space time with the Lorentz group O(9+1). Embedding of the higher exceptional groups will also be presented.
